Source

pub const fn const_em_fractional(pre_comma: isize, post_comma: isize) -> Self

Creates an em value from a fractional number in const context.

§Arguments
  • pre_comma - The integer part (e.g., 1 for 1.5em)
  • post_comma - The fractional part as digits (e.g., 5 for 0.5em, 83 for 0.83em)
§Examples
// 1.5em = const_em_fractional(1, 5)
// 0.83em = const_em_fractional(0, 83)
// 1.17em = const_em_fractional(1, 17)

Source

pub fn to_percent(&self) -> Option<NormalizedPercentage>

Returns the value of the SizeMetric as a normalized percentage (0.0 = 0%, 1.0 = 100%)

Returns Some(NormalizedPercentage) if this is a percentage value, None otherwise. The returned NormalizedPercentage is already normalized to 0.0-1.0 range, so you should multiply it directly with the containing block size.

Source

pub fn resolve_with_context( &self, context: &ResolutionContext, property_context: PropertyContext, ) -> f32

Resolve this value to pixels using proper CSS context.

This is the CORRECT way to resolve CSS units. It properly handles:

  • em units: Uses element’s own font-size (or parent’s for font-size property)
  • rem units: Uses root element’s font-size
  • % units: Uses property-appropriate reference (containing block width/height, element size, etc.)
  • Absolute units: px, pt, in, cm, mm (already correct)
§Arguments
  • context - Resolution context with font sizes and dimensions
  • property_context - Which property we’re resolving for (affects % and em resolution)
